

Elizabeth “Betty” Camp, 84, of Tekonsha, passed away September 5, 2012. She was born January 6, 1928 in Colon to Earl and Bertha (Collins) McAtee.
In 1929 when her grandfather McAtee died, the family moved to a farm in Sherwood to be with her grandmother. When her mother died in 1932, her grandmother bought and moved the family to a farm northwest of Tekonsha, (Now the Harvey farm) where she grew up. Except for two years in Battle Creek her life was spent in Tekonsha. Betty attended the French School through the 6th grade and graduated from Tekonsha High School.
She married Clarence “Vern” Camp June 16, 1946 in Coldwater. He preceded her in death December 1985. Betty worked several years at W.K.Kellogg Company and retired from the Coldwater Regional Center.
She belonged to Union Church United Church of Christ, Tekonsha Research Club, Tekonsha Library Board, S.E.R.A. (State Employees Retirement Association) and Bid and Bite bridge club. She was an avid bowler for many years and golfed in later years.
Betty is survived by daughters; Linda Geer of Tekonsha, Patti (Bud) Woods of Marshall, Janet (and the late Mike) Woods of Marshall, 10 grandchildren, 15 great grandchildren, one brother, Carl McAtee of Leesburg, FL. She was preceded in death by her husband, parents, step mother, 2 brothers, Vern McAtee, Richard McAtee and half brother David McAtee.
